Georgia Bulldogs receiver Colbie Young suspended due to assault charges

Young is the 8th Georgia football player to be arrested this year

In a troubling turn of events for the Georgia Bulldogs football team, wide receiver Colbie Young has been suspended indefinitely following his arrest on serious assault charges. The incident has raised significant concerns regarding player conduct and the responsibilities of collegiate athletes.

Details of the arrest

According to reports from ESPN, Young was taken into custody on misdemeanor charges of battery and assault of an unborn child. The arrest occurred on Oct. 8, and Young was released later that day on a $3,800 bond. This incident marks him as the eighth Georgia football player arrested in 2024, a statistic that has drawn scrutiny from fans and analysts alike.


Coach Kirby Smart’s response

Head coach Kirby Smart addressed the media regarding Young’s suspension during a Southeastern Conference coaches teleconference. He stated, “He’s been suspended indefinitely until this legal matter is resolved.” Smart emphasized the importance of educating players about the serious nature of such incidents, expressing regret over the situation. “It’s very unfortunate, but we want to be responsible in decision-making on and off the field,” he added.

What the police report reveals

The police report, obtained by ESPN, details a confrontation between Young and his ex-girlfriend. The woman, aged 20, visited Young’s apartment to discuss their relationship. However, the conversation escalated after she discovered him on the phone with another woman. According to her account, Young physically removed her from his room, using derogatory language in the process.


As the situation intensified, Young allegedly grabbed her from behind and squeezed her torso and abdomen, leading her to fear for her safety. Officers noted visible injuries on the woman, including bruising and redness, prompting her to seek medical attention.

Young’s defense

In response to the allegations, Young’s attorney, Kim Stephens, asserted that Young did not engage in any physical contact that could be deemed criminal. “I expect Mr. Young to be fully exonerated once our investigation is complete and the truth revealed,” Stephens stated, indicating confidence in Young’s innocence.

Impact on the Bulldogs

Smart acknowledged the challenges of managing a large roster of young athletes, stating, “When you have 130 17 to 23-year-olds, you’re going to have issues.” He expressed a commitment to improving the situation and emphasized the need for players to make better decisions off the field. “It’s tough, but that’s the cost of leadership,” he remarked, highlighting the responsibility coaches have in guiding their players.
